About the Role

The Technical Consulting Manager is responsible for leading and managing a team of survey specialists, overseeing the end-to-end delivery of compliance survey projects, ensuring operational excellence, quality assurance, and client satisfaction. The role acts as the primary client interface, providing expert interpretation of findings, strategic recommendations, and guidance on compliance improvement initiatives. The Technical Consulting Manager ensures all projects are delivered on time, within scope, and to the highest quality standards while maintaining strong client relationships and supporting business growth.

Key Responsibilities

  • Lead, develop, and manage a team of Technical Consultancy Engineers and technical specialists, creating a high-performing and customer-focused culture.
  • Oversee the successful delivery of compliance survey programmes, ensuring quality, consistency, efficiency, and regulatory compliance.
  • Manage multiple client projects from planning through to completion, ensuring deliverables are achieved on time and within scope.
  • Provide technical oversight and quality assurance of survey outputs, reports, and recommendations.
  • Act as the primary client contact, presenting findings, advising on compliance risks, and building strong stakeholder relationships.
  • Monitor resources, workloads, and project performance, identifying risks and driving continuous improvement.
  • Support business growth by identifying opportunities to enhance services and strengthen client partnerships.

Key Skills and Experience

Essential

  • Experience managing technical consulting teams and client-facing projects.
  • Demonstrable experience overseeing compliance surveys, audits, inspections, or technical assessment programmes.
  • Excellent report & pricing review, quality assurance, and analytical skills.
  • Strong stakeholder management and client advisory capabilities, with the ability to communicate complex technical information to both technical and non-technical audiences.

Desirable

  • Strong organisational, project management, and operational delivery experience.
  • Experience managing multiple concurrent projects and priorities.
  • Professional qualification in a relevant technical, engineering, compliance, or consultancy discipline.
  • Experience within regulated environments.

About Insite

Established in 2009, Insite Energy is a dynamic, fast-growing company that provides services to heat network suppliers in the UK. The services provided include metering & billing of residential customers, the installation (and retrofit) of credit billed and pay-as-you-go equipment, and ongoing maintenance and management of the heat network schemes.

We pride ourselves on our commitment to working as one team to put the customer and client first, delivering a reliable, competitive, and professional service. We are tireless in our efforts to be the best at what we do, which is reflected in our Trustpilot rating. With just over 120 current employees, we are small but mighty, delivering more by working together.
